Community Pop‑Up Health Event – September 29, 2025
“Connecting our neighbors to care, resources, and support, because everyone deserves a healthy future.”
On Monday, September 29, Kansas Impact Coalition hosted a free community‑health pop‑up at St. John’s Missionary Baptist Church (215 S Chicago St., Salina).
Event Highlights:
The Salina Family Healthcare Center’s mobile unit was on‑site, offering free health screenings including blood pressure checks.
Attendees were given “Purple Card” assistance (a program linked to SFHC for patients seeking care with limited or no insurance).
Grab‑and‑go sack lunches, snacks, water and gift cards were provided to support and engage attendees.
The event aimed to connect community members with health care, transportation (bus passes), and resource services.
